Donnafugata
Ben Ryè Passito di Pantelleria DOC

€34.50

Ben Ryé 2020 has a golden color with bright amber hues. The very intense bouquet ranges from fruity notes of apricot and candied orange peel, to hints of Mediterranean scrub. On the palate the fruity hints of aromatic herbs are combined with sweet nuances of honey. Intense and persistent, with an extraordinary balance between freshness and sweetness, Ben Ryè is a captivating Passito di Pantelleria, among wines most popular desserts in the world.

Pairings: Perfect with dry pastries, chocolate and jam or ricotta tarts. Try also with blue cheese and foie gras. Extraordinary on its own, as a meditation wine. Serve it in tulip-shaped goblets of medium size, slightly bellied; uncork at time of serving; excellent at 14° C (57° F).

La Montecchia
Particella 200 - Cabernet Franc Veneto IGT

€14.50

The Veneto Cabernet Franc IGT "Particella 200" of the La Montecchia company is obtained from Cabernet Franc grapes grown on medium-textured clay soils, with trachytic outcrops and slate. After maturing in steel and vitrified concrete barrels, it ages at least two months before being marketed. A wine with great balance and drinkability, it is ample and stands out for its lively freshness.

Intense ruby ​​red color. The nose is fine; fruity hints of blackberries and blueberries dominate, followed by those of spices. On the palate it is soft, full-bodied and pleasant to drink, persistent.

Excellent in combination with grilled, grilled or roasted red meats, it also goes well with first courses and aged cheeses.

Vignaioli di Scansano
Ciliegiolo Capoccia Maremma Toscana DOC

€9.50

Fruity and round, Ciliegiolo Maremma Toscana Doc Capoccia has the perfect easy going character that makes an ordinary meal special.

Maremma Toscana Doc Capoccia is a luminous ruby red. On the nose it bestows pleasant fruity scents of cherries and fruits of the forest together with flowery hints. On the palate it is dry, fruity, enjoyable and rightly balanced with elegant tannins and a long fruity finish.

Grapes: Ciliegiolo 85%, Alicante 15%
Age of vines: 10-15 years
Maturation: in stainless steel tanks for 3 months on fine lees.
Refining: in bottle for at least 3 months.
Ageing potential: good when young, it lets its light shine within 2 years.
Food pairing: with rich pasta dishes with meat based sauces and red meat main dishes.

Ezio Poggio
Archetipo Timorasso - Terre di Libarna Colli Tortonesi DOC

€24.50

The Timorasso dei Colli Tortonesi Terre di Libarna DOC "Archetipo" from the Poggio Ezio winery comes from plants grown with the utmost rigor and respect for nature and the environment. The vines are placed on clayey and calcareous soils and harvested by hand, in small boxes, to preserve the high quality of the raw material.

the vinification begins with a soft pressing, then it is fermented in steel and for about 1 year it is always refined in stainless steel, with a permanence on the fine lees. A further refinement in the bottle for at least 6 months, before being released on the market.

Bright straw yellow to the eye, the nose offers mineral sensations and white flowers, which with aging turn to more complex notes of hydrocarbons and flint. It is perfectly acid, savory and full-bodied, good structure and persistence.

Perfect wine for first and second courses of fish, also suitable for meat.

Chianti Colli Senesi "Arciduca" - Cappella Sant'Andrea

€16.50

This Chianti is produced following the principles of biodynamic agriculture; completed the vinification, it ages in cement and, after a short rest in the bottle, it is released for marketing. The wine expresses the typical character of Sangiovese, plum, violet and cherry. Ruby red color.

Excellent with first courses with meat sauces, or with grilled red meats
